ESRB ratings for Grand Theft Auto III and Grand Theft Auto: Vice City have appeared on the ESRB’s website, reports iGo Gaming. This possibly indicates that the two iconic open world crime games will be landing on digital platforms. Had San Andreas been listed, it’s possible that we could have speculated on an HD collection, but since that’s not the case, the downloadable remakes definitely seem more likely.
Both Grand Theft Auto III and Vice City are rated M for Mature, which should come as no surprise to anyone, because really, why would it? What is worth noting is the fact that both titles are only listed for the PlayStation 3. That said, the games will probably land on Xbox Live Arcade, as well.
Last October, Rockstar Games celebrated the 10-year anniversary of Grand Theft Auto III. With that in mind, it should also be mentioned that this coming October will mark the 10-year anniversary for Vice City, a game that delivered more of what we loved from its predecessor in a brand new setting. I think we can expect both of these classics to resurface sometime before the end of 2012.
